Nota Bene: Majors must take 8 hours of literature, at least 4 of which must be selected from 346 or 347. Thus a student could fulfill the 8-hour literature requirement by taking 346 and 347, or 346 and two 2-hour lit. courses, or 347 and two 2-hour lit. courses. French Film counts as a literature course.

French Minor Requirements: 20 hours beyond intermediate level. Required courses are 331 and 346 or 347. Other courses, which may include Wheaton in France, should be selected in consultation with a department advisor.
